Hoofers, Heathens and Hope Warriors: A Benefit for Gina Dawson

Hosted by Rhodessa Jones and the Medea Project

Gina Dawson, a core ensemble member and choreographer for the Medea Project: Theater for Incarcerated Women for the last twenty years, is battling late stages of myleoma cancer and the artists of the Bay Area are coming together to show our support.

Specifically, on Friday January 25, the top Bay Area performing artists will be putting on an amazing show at Brava Theater, hosted by Rhodessa Jones and the Medea Project: Theater for Incarcerated Women. There will be actors, dancers, musicians and poets. Food, drinks and a raffle with great prizes. It will be an amazing time and we hope you will join us! All proceeds will go to help Gina.

Confirmed Performers include: Bryan Dyer, Steve Hogan, Idris Ackamoor, Frederick Harris, Keith Hennessy, Traci Bartlow, and Amara T. Smith and the fabulous MEDEA PROJECT ensemble!
